Various types of medical applications of antennas have widely been investigated. Since these antennas are used in and around a human body, the size of the antennas must be small. Particularly, in order to realize minimally invasive treatment, small-size antennas are desired. This paper describes a few antennas for hyperthermia which is one of thermal therapies for cancer. Hyperthermia is one of the modalities for cancer treatment, utilizing the difference of thermal sensitivity between tumor and normal tissue. Up to now, the authors have been studying various coaxial-slot antennas for microwave hyperthermia.
